    Hornet stripping query

    I need to get the hammer out and clean it up as I suspect water has got in there and its a bit sticky. Can anyone mail me how to details please. I've got the trigger off but am now stuck!

    Darren you need to remove the probe thumb button. To do this unscrew the thumb button on the back of the probe, you will need two pairs of pliers and protect the metal. When this is off you will need to push the probe back in until it locks in place, to remove the allen stud at the back, (if you wish to remove the probe:-then with the stud removed screw the thumb button back in and keep releasing it, the weight of the spring should knock out the probe and guide.) When this is out of the way, you can then remove the end cap and the spring and hammer. You may not need to remove the probe, but you will have to remove the thumb button to remove the allen stud as this is one of the pair that holds the end cap on.
